Output 43348b17d902c2fe8d69a266addfc315ac52a4dfab799409a181f528748c1fd3:3

value
809137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3535f79fb6f953351c0e9b2ab5db442df8a281a2 OP_EQUAL
address
36YNPRVopR3rcXL2MAWvuUjGYdunB9nxzw
transaction
43348b17d902c2fe8d69a266addfc315ac52a4dfab799409a181f528748c1fd3
spent
true